Is "God's Country" a good walkup song?
The slow build matches a deliberate walk to the box — this is not a song for slap hitters in a hurry. Blake Shelton's vocal carries authority. And the lyrical content (faith, land, work) fits a specific kind of player identity that resonates with rural and southern programs.

How to trim "God's Country" for a walkup
Start at 0:00, run for 22 seconds. The slow build and Blake's vocal entrance are the hook. Use the full intro.
The trim point is the difference between a great walkup song and a great walkup. A song's first 15-20 seconds rarely happen to be the best 15-20 seconds — most popular tracks have a build, an intro, or a bridge before the hook lands. Pick the slice that hits hardest. The last second of your trim window should land on a peak, right as the player steps into the box.
